GOLD Coast’s sporting royalty Courtney Hancock has announced her long-awaited engagement to Australian cricketer Nick Buchanan.

The son of former Australian coach John Buchanan appears to have dropped a knee in front of his partner of six years, 33, in the lead up to Christmas while on a recent trip to Noosa.

The striking couple took to social media on Thursday evening to share the exciting news with their combined 22,000-plus Instagram followers.

Though few details are known about the proposal, Ms Hancock proudly showed off her new accessory with an image captioned: “And just like that..... YES to my forever,” she wrote.

The post has since garnered close to 3000 likes, also drawing more than 300 comments from some of the Coast’s biggest names congratulating the pair on their happy news.

Radio identity Emily Jade O’Keeffe said: “OMG! I’ve been waiting for this and literally squealed.”

Ironman Matt Poole welcomed the news while Olympian Giaan Rooney labelled the announcement the “best news ever.”

It’s been a big year professionally for Ms Hancock, cementing herself as the first woman to win four Coolangatta Gold titles last month.
